        宋代則例初探

        이운룡 ( Yunlong Li ) 한국중국학회 2015 中國學報 Vol.72 No.-

        The 「li」was one of the Chinese ancient legal forms, which occupied an important position in the Chinese ancient legal system, and played an extremely important role. The Song dynasty was the key stage of the development of the li. The li of the Song dynasty include the judicial li and the administrative li, the former part mainly means the 「duanli」, while the latter part consist of the 「tiaoli」、 「geli」、「zeli」、「shili」and so on. As one of the administrative li in the Song dynasty, zeli played an important role in the legal system. Zeli got more use with the development of the society and economy in the Song dynasty and the intensive management to the local area by the central government. The zeli of the Song dynasty include two parts, which were about the dispose of the affairs of the central and local governments, especially the management of the officials’ salary and the levy of the tax. According to the different constitutors, the zeli of the Song dynasty include the zeli enacted by the central government, local government and the officer. The specific character of the zeli decide it have an advantage that the other legal forms do not have. The zeli of the Song dynasty was endowed with legal force; it means that the one who violate zeli will be punished. The zeli of the Song and Qing dynasty has both similarities and differences. The similarities were instantiated in the position, problem and feature. Yet, the differences were instantiated in the form, content and application.

        Analysis of oligosaccharides from Panax ginseng by using solid-phase permethylation method combined with ultra-high-performance liquid chromatography-Q-Orbitrap/mass spectrometry

        Li, Lele,Ma, Li,Guo, Yunlong,Liu, Wenlong,Wang, Yang,Liu, Shuying The Korean Society of Ginseng 2020 Journal of Ginseng Research Vol.44 No.6

        Background: The reports about valuable oligosaccharides in ginseng are quite limited. There is an urgent need to develop a practical procedure to detect and analyze ginseng oligosaccharides. Methods: The oligosaccharide extracts from ginseng were permethylated by solid-phase methylation method and then were analyzed by ultra-high-performance liquid chromatography-Q-Orbitrap/MS. The sequence, linkage, and configuration information of oligosaccharides were determined by using accurate m/z value and tandem mass information. Several standard references were used to further confirm the identification. The oligosaccharide composition in white ginseng and red ginseng was compared using a multivariate statistical analysis method. Results: The nonreducing oligosaccharide erlose among 12 oligosaccharides identified was reported for the first time in ginseng. In the comparison of the oligosaccharide extracts from white ginseng and red ginseng, a clear separation was observed in the partial least squares-discriminate analysis score plot, indicating the sugar differences in these two kinds of ginseng samples. The glycans with variable importance in the projection value large than 1.0 were considered to contribute most to the classification. The contents of oligosaccharides in red ginseng were lower than those in white ginseng, and the contents of maltose, maltotriose, maltotetraose, maltopentaose, maltohexaose, maltoheptaose, maltooctaose, maltononaose, sucrose, and erlose decreased significantly (p < 0.05) in red ginseng. Conclusion: A solid-phase methylation method combined with liquid chromatography-tandem mass spectrometry was successfully applied to analyze the oligosaccharides in ginseng extracts, which provides the possibility for holistic evaluation of ginseng oligosaccharides. The comparison of oligosaccharide composition of white ginseng and red ginseng could help understand the differences in pharmacological activities between these two kinds of ginseng samples from the perspective of glycans.

        Microstructure and Hydrogen Absorption Properties of a BCC Phase Accompanied Laves Alloy

        Yunlong Zhang,Tiebang Zhang,Jinshan Li,Ruolin Li,Yun Yu,Yalin Lu 대한금속·재료학회 2019 METALS AND MATERIALS International Vol.25 No.3

        A non-stoichiometry Zr0.7Ti0.4V1.5Cr0.4alloy has been synthesized by arc melting following annealing treatment or meltspinningto obtain the bulk and ribbon samples, respectively. XRD investigation reveals the multiphase structure consistingof C15-Laves, V-BCC and a small amount of α-Zr or Zr3V3O. The alloy shows easy activation and fast hydrogenationkinetics. The annealed alloy absorbs 2.51 wt% H at room temperature, higher than the melt-spun ribbons. Refined grains bymelt-spinning accelerates the hydrogenation of bulk alloy. The absorption behavior in presence of 1 mol% air has been testedto evaluate the anti-poisoning ability. Pressure–composition–temperature characteristics and thermodynamics parametersindicate the low equilibrium pressure and high hydrides stability. Hydrides investigation reveals that the Laves phase dominantmultiphase structure contributes to the enhanced hydrogen capacity and multi-stage hydrogen release in DSC curve.

        Effects of the Inlet Position of Blade on the Performance of a Centrifugal Impeller

        Yunlong Li,Ruizi Zhang,Kaibin Wang,Jingyin Li 한국유체기계학회 2018 International journal of fluid machinery and syste Vol.11 No.3

        The effects of the inlet position of blade on the performance of a centrifugal impeller are numerically investigated. The inlet position of the blade can be determined by the outer diameter, the leaning angle of the blade inlet, the shroud and hub angular momentums specified at the blade inlet. It is found that the flow fields of the optimal impeller are obviously superior to those of the impeller whose blade leading edge was installed at impeller eye. The range analyses reveal that angular momentum specified at the inlet hub is the least important factor in affecting the efficiency of impeller, while the outer diameter of blade leading edge plays the most important role in determining the pressure ratio.

        A Novel Tunable Dual-band Left-Handed Metamaterial

        Si Li,Atef Z. Elsherbeni,Wenhua Yu,Wenxing Li,Yunlong Mao 한국자기학회 2017 Journal of Magnetics Vol.22 No.4

        In this paper, we propose a novel tunable left-handed metamaterial (LHM), the capacitor-loaded short wire pairs (CL-SWPs). It is composed of a pair of short wires connected through a variable capacitor. This LHM is single-sided, and it exhibits not only tunable negative permeability, but also a wide band negative permittivity. It is pointed out with theoretical analysis that its left-handed performance is related to the mutual coupling coefficient. A tunable dual-band LHM is also proposed by simply adding a double slits split ring resonator to this LHM. The simulated results indicate that the closer the two LH bands are, the better performance the CLSWP related left-handed band is, hence identifying our theoretical analysis. The proposed structure is geometrically simple, low-cost and easy for fabrication, and it can be used as a basic particle in the design of tunable multi-band LHMs.

        EFFECTS OF COOPERATIVE VEHICLE INFRASTRUCTURE SYSTEM ON DRIVER’S VISUAL AND DRIVING PERFORMANCE BASED ON COGNITION PROCESS

        Xuewei Li,Zhenlong Li,Xiaohua Zhao,Jian Rong,Yunlong Zhang 한국자동차공학회 2022 International journal of automotive technology Vol.23 No.5

        This study explores the influence of cooperative vehicle infrastructure system (CVIS) on the driver’s visual and driving performance. Taking the work zone as an example, a driving simulation experiment involving 37 drivers has been conducted to collect driver’s eye movement and vehicle running data in the same scenario with and without CVIS information respectively. Next, the nonparametric test and grey relational analysis (GRA) have been used to compare the specific performance and to analyze the correlations among the multi-stage of driver’s information process. The results present that CVIS information has the potential to alleviate the driver’s tension and the difficulty of information perception. Meanwhile, the driver tends to search visual information more actively and complete the lane changing behavior earlier. Further analysis indicates that CVIS information can reduce the influence of mental workload on lane-changing decisions, and enhance the correlation between visual information processing and lane-changing decisions, as well as the effect of decision-making timing on the running state. Therefore, drivers’ speed control ability was improved and the traffic flow was smoother. The findings give an insight into the influence mechanism of the cooperative information on driving performance and provide a direction for a comprehensive assessment of CVIS based on human factors.

        宋代格例新探

        이운룡 ( Yunlong Li ) 한국중국학회 2016 中國學報 Vol.76 No.-

        Abstract: The Geli was a legal form began to appear in the Tang dynasty, which was mainly used in the administrative affairs. After the development during the Five Dynasties, the Geli had further improved in the Song dynasty and became part of the legal system at that time. There was a strongrelation ship between Geli and Ge. The Geli originated from the practice that according to the regulations of Ge、Chi and law. Compared with the former dynasty, the application of the Geli in the Song dynasty were more active and frequent. The Geli of the Song dynasty was applied in the administrative affairs too,such as the selection、evaluation and reward of the government officials. The Geli also played animportant role in the management of the local affairs. Due to the wide range of applications, the standarddegree and legal validity of Geli were improved a lot in the Song dynasty

        Effects of the Guiding Tank on Flow Characteristics inside the Double-Suction Squirrel-Cage Fan for Range Hood

        Yingkun Zhang,Kunhang Li,Yunlong Li,Jingyin Li 한국유체기계학회 2020 International journal of fluid machinery and syste Vol.13 No.1

        The effects of the guiding tank on flow characteristics inside a double-suction squirrel-cage fan for the range hood were numerically investigated in this paper. Flow analysis was conducted by solving the three-dimensional steady Reynolds-averaged Navier-Stokes equations using the realizable k- turbulence model. Numerical results were validated with the experimental data for total pressure. Differences in flow characteristics between the fan model and the range hood model at the nearly maximum mass flow rate of 0.3214 kg/s were analyzed in detail. Numerical simulation results show that the incoming flow of the squirrel-cage fan will be distorted due to the guiding tank. The inlet distortion will deteriorate the aerodynamic performance of the squirrel-cage fan and cause obvious differences in the velocity field, the pressure field and the vortex structures inside the fan.

        Seismic performance of RC columns with full resistance spot welding stirrups

        Yunlong Yu,Zhaohui Dang,Yong Yang,Yang Chen,Hui Li 국제구조공학회 2020 Structural Engineering and Mechanics, An Int'l Jou Vol.73 No.5

        This paper aims to investigate the seismic performance of RC short columns and long columns with welding stirrups. Through the low-cyclic horizontal loading test of specimens, the seismic performance indexes such as failure modes, hysteretic curve, skeleton curve, ductility, energy dissipation capacity, stiffness degradation and strength degradation were emphatically analyzed. Furthermore, the effects of shear span ratio, stirrups ratio and axial compression ratio on the performance of specimens were studied. The results showed that the seismic performance of the RC short columns with welding stirrups were basically the same as that of the RC short columns with traditional stirrups, but the seismic performance of RC long columns with welding stirrups was better than that of RC long columns with traditional stirrups. The seismic performance of RC short columns and long columns with welding stirrups could be improved by increasing stirrup ratio and shear span ratio and reducing axial pressure ratio. Moreover, the welding stirrup have the advantages of steel saving, industrialization and standardization production, convenient construction, and reducing time, which indicated that the welding stirrups could be applied in practical engineering.

      • Improving Public Health Multidimensional Services through the Use of Smart Cloud Model

        Li Kai,Yang Hua,Zhang Yunlong,Yang Zhehan,Zhu Yan,XinYing,Meng Qun 보안공학연구지원센터 2015 International Journal of Smart Home Vol.9 No.8

        To better understand the practical applications of smart cloud technology in response to public services improvement, this paper researches the application results of Smart Cloud Model Based Public Health Multidimensional Services (SCMBPHMS). Different from the previous studies that focused on the details, this paper establishes a relatively macroscopic large model of SCMBPHMS, we have established a knowledge model based on artificial neural network on the model data processing to sense various users’ data acquisition habits of SCMBPHMS and let Public Health Smart Cloud Service (PHSCS) gaining the function of intelligent mining and data intelligent classification via training library. Finally, we give the example of some important features of SCMBPHMS via PHP language. In future, SCMBPHMS combined with the Residents' Health Card will greatly influence the quality of Public Healthcare Services
